EX6 8JN is in Powderham, Exeter and Teignbridge district. EX6 8JN is located in the Kenn Valley elect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Central Devon.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is EX6 8JN d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around EX6 8JN was 61.7 per 1,000 residents, which is 48.9% higher than the Dawlish South West average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

EX6 8JN has the 12th highest crime rate of 27 local areas in Dawlish South West and the 142nd highest crime rate of 430 local areas in Teignbridge .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 36.1 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-62.6%.
